'O del mio amato ben' is a beautiful Italian art song composed by Stefano Donaudy. It was composed in the early 20th century and premiered in 1915. The song is a part of a collection of 36 songs called '36 Arie di Stile Antico' (36 Arias of Ancient Style) which was published in 1897. The song is written in a simple and elegant style, with a melody that is both lyrical and expressive. It is a love song, expressing the deep emotions of a lover for his beloved. The song is composed in the key of G major and has a moderate tempo. It is a solo vocal piece, accompanied by a piano.
